Output 2508567101c710c954913fad7aa12326902037e1cfc0f9ede638b0ee9ead47bb:119

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 5d72d971aa74d3bef45290d13ff0ba817b5e0c71
address
bc1qt4edjud2wnfmaazjjrgnlu96s9a4urr36v0f8d
transaction
2508567101c710c954913fad7aa12326902037e1cfc0f9ede638b0ee9ead47bb
spent
true